In recent years, events around the world have raised many questions in the hearts and minds of both believers and non-believers alike. We can look at some of the most horrible and devastating events to have occurred in decades. The tsunami waves that hit in the Indian Ocean were the result of one of the most powerful earthquakes ever recorded. Hurricane Katrina destroyed the city of New Orleans.

But what does that mean to both believers and non-believers? Is this an "act of God" as insurance companies put it, or is it God punishing the world for some reason? As a believer, who understands the love and mercy of God the Father of our Lord Jesus Christ, my answer to these questions is no, definitely not. It was not an act of God and it was not a punishment of God. What is it then, you may ask?

To understand what has happened we need to look at the beginning of creation.

In the beginning God created the Earth and everything in it, God saw it and God decided it was Good. God was pleased with all he had created for it was perfect, nothing was wrong with it. God placed Adam and Eve in a perfect environment, it was exactly what they needed to live and fellowship with God. What happened then? Satan came, deceived Eve and tempted Adam and sin entered the world.

Adam was created to have dominion over all the Earth, but he sinned and gave the authority to the enemy, Satan and sin, and the consequences of sin entered the world.

This event took place during the temptation of Christ. Satan, the devil, plainly tells Jesus that all the kingdoms of the world, belong to him, that includes everything about them. Satan tells Jesus that the world has been delivered to him. When, you ask? When Adam gave it to him. Satan is the God of this world as explained in the following verse.

Yes, not only does man suffer the ravages of sin, but the Earth does also. Earthquakes, floods, famine, drought, and every other act of nature tell us two things. That satan, the god of this world, destroys everything he touches, including nature, and innocent people as a result, but also it gives us a great hope, because to the believer it heralds in the second coming of Christ. Yes, I do believe that all the things that have happened in the past fifty years or so, are leading to the return of our Lord and Savior, Jesus Christ.
